npm是在开发中常用的工具之一,本文将详细介绍如何设置npm本地服务器 。步骤简单易懂,让开发者们可以快速地搭建出自己的本地npm服务器 。
1. 安装cnpm
首先,我们需要安装cnpm,也就是淘宝镜像的命令行工具 。打开终端,输入以下命令即可:
$ npm install -g cnpm --registry=https://registry.npm.taobao.org
安装完成后,使用cnpm代替npm来进行安装和管理包 。
2. 初始化
接下来,我们需要在本地创建一个npm仓库 。在终端中进入到你想要创建仓库的目录,执行以下命令:
$ cnpm init
按照提示进行配置,输入完毕后会在当前目录下生成一个package.json文件 。
3. 安装sinopia
sinopia是一个基于node.js的私有npm仓库服务器,我们将使用它来搭建本地npm服务器 。安装sinopia非常简单,只需在终端中执行以下命令即可:
$ cnpm install -g sinopia
4. 启动sinopia
安装完sinopia后 , 我们需要启动它 。在终端中进入到仓库目录,执行以下命令:
$ sinopia
这时候,我们就成功地启动了本地的sinopia服务器 。
5. 配置npm
最后 , 我们需要将npm指向我们刚刚启动的sinopia服务器 。在终端中执行以下命令:
$ npm set registry http://localhost:4873/
至此,我们已经成功地将npm指向了本地的sinopia服务器,可以愉快地使用它来安装和管理包了 。
【如何在本地搭建npm服务器? npm怎么设置本地服务器】通过以上步骤,我们可以快速地搭建出自己的本地npm服务器,方便我们对各种包的管理 。在开发中,这是一个非常有用的技能,能够帮助我们更加高效地完成开发工作 。
推荐阅读
- 如何设置虚拟手柄服务器并推荐哪些? 虚拟手柄服务器推荐吗怎么设置
- 使用服务器搭建IP代理的步骤及方法是什么? 怎么用服务器搭建ip代理
- 如何搭建虚拟打印服务器? 虚拟打印服务器怎么弄
- mongodb操作 mongodb消息队列使用
- 如何利用服务器搭建自己的IP地址? 怎么用服务器搭建ip
- 如何使用虚拟拨号服务器? 虚拟拨号服务器怎么用
- 如何创建自己的npm服务器? npm服务器怎么创建
- 服务器上如何建立MQTT通信? 怎么用服务器搭建mqtt